NC Border Protests

NC Border Protests

The freedom fighters helping to protest the NC helmet statute at the Bikers NOT Welcome to North Carolina sign is a fun-loving group from ABATE of South Carolina. They rode lidless into NC in protest, but didn't spend one tourist dollar, then rode back to their biker-friendly state. NC is potentially missing out on millions of tourist dollars every year! Is it true that SC bikers love freedom more than NC bikers? NO! It's just that they didn't give up, and they went to their statehouse in great numbers, and got a repeal in 1987. They continue to get hundreds of bikers to their statehouse to protect their freedoms and rights every year. Their legislators listen to them.
